#!/usr/bin/env bash
#
# pgpool-II regression test driver.
#
# usage: regress.sh [test_name]
# -i install directory of pgpool
# -b pgbench path
# -p installation path of Postgres
# -j JDBC driver path
# -m install (install pgpool-II and use that for tests) / noinstall : Default install
# -s unix socket directory
# -c test pgpool using sample scripts and config files
# -d start pgpool with debug option
dir=`pwd`
MODE=install
PG_INSTALL_DIR=/usr/local/pgsql/bin
PGPOOL_PATH=/usr/local
JDBC_DRIVER=/usr/local/pgsql/share/postgresql-9.2-1003.jdbc4.jar
#export USE_REPLICATION_SLOT=true
export log=$dir/log
fail=0
ok=0
timeout=0
PGSOCKET_DIR=/tmp,/var/run/postgresql
CRED=$(tput setaf 1)
CGREEN=$(tput setaf 2)
CBLUE=$(tput setaf 4)
CNORM=$(tput sgr0)
# timeout for each test (5 min.)
TIMEOUT=300
function install_pgpool
{
echo "creating pgpool-II temporary installation ..."
PGPOOL_PATH=$dir/temp/installed
test -d $log || mkdir $log
make install WATCHDOG_DEBUG=1 -C $dir/../../ -e prefix=${PGPOOL_PATH} >& regression.log 2>&1
if [ $? != 0 ];then
echo "make install failed"
exit 1
fi
echo "moving pgpool_setup to temporary installation path ..."
cp $dir/../pgpool_setup ${PGPOOL_PATH}/pgpool_setup
export PGPOOL_SETUP=$PGPOOL_PATH/pgpool_setup
echo "moving watchdog_setup to temporary installation path ..."
cp $dir/../watchdog_setup ${PGPOOL_PATH}/watchdog_setup
export WATCHDOG_SETUP=$PGPOOL_PATH/watchdog_setup
}
function verify_pginstallation
{
# PostgreSQL bin directory
PGBIN=`$PG_INSTALL_DIR/pg_config --bindir`
if [ -z $PGBIN ]; then
echo "$0: cannot locate pg_config"
exit 1
fi
# PostgreSQL lib directory
PGLIB=`$PG_INSTALL_DIR/pg_config --libdir`
if [ -z $PGLIB ]; then
echo "$0: cannot locate pg_config"
exit 1
fi
}
function export_env_vars
{
if [[ -z "$PGPOOL_PATH" ]]; then
# check if pgpool is in the path
PGPOOL_PATH=/usr/local
export PGPOOL_SETUP=$HOME/bin/pgpool_setup
export WATCHDOG_SETUP=$HOME/bin/watchdog_setup
fi
if [[ -z "$PGBENCH_PATH" ]]; then
if [ -x $PGBIN/pgbench ]; then
PGBENCH_PATH=$PGBIN/pgbench
else
PGBENCH_PATH=`which pgbench`
fi
fi
if [ ! -x $PGBENCH_PATH ]; then
echo "$0] cannot locate pgbench"; exit 1
fi
echo "using pgpool-II at "$PGPOOL_PATH
export PGPOOL_VERSION=`$PGPOOL_PATH/bin/pgpool --version 2>&1`
export PGPOOL_INSTALL_DIR=$PGPOOL_PATH
# where to look for pgpool.conf.sample files.
export PGPOOLDIR=${PGPOOLDIR:-"$PGPOOL_INSTALL_DIR/etc"}
PGPOOLLIB=${PGPOOL_INSTALL_DIR}/lib
if [ -z "$LD_LIBRARY_PATH" ];then
export LD_LIBRARY_PATH=${PGPOOLLIB}:${PGLIB}
else
export LD_LIBRARY_PATH=${PGPOOLLIB}:${PGLIB}:${LD_LIBRARY_PATH}
fi
export TESTLIBS=$dir/libs.sh
export PGBIN=$PGBIN
export JDBC_DRIVER=$JDBC_DRIVER
export PGBENCH_PATH=$PGBENCH_PATH
export PGSOCKET_DIR=$PGSOCKET_DIR
export PGVERSION=`$PGBIN/initdb -V|awk '{print $3}'|sed 's/\..*//'`
export LANG=C
export ENABLE_TEST=true
}
function print_info
{
echo ${CBLUE}"*************************"${CNORM}
echo "REGRESSION MODE : "${CBLUE}$MODE${CNORM}
echo "Pgpool-II version : "${CBLUE}$PGPOOL_VERSION${CNORM}
echo "Pgpool-II install path : "${CBLUE}$PGPOOL_PATH${CNORM}
echo "PostgreSQL bin : "${CBLUE}$PGBIN${CNORM}
echo "PostgreSQL Major version : "${CBLUE}$PGVERSION${CNORM}
echo "pgbench : "${CBLUE}$PGBENCH_PATH${CNORM}
echo "PostgreSQL jdbc : "${CBLUE}$JDBC_DRIVER${CNORM}
echo ${CBLUE}"*************************"${CNORM}
}
function print_usage
{
printf "Usage:\n"
printf " %s: [Options]... [test_name]\n" $(basename $0) >&2
printf "\nOptions:\n"
printf " -p DIRECTORY Postgres installed directory\n" >&2
printf " -b PATH pgbench installed path, if different from Postgres installed directory\n" >&2
printf " -i DIRECTORY pgpool installed directory, if already installed pgpool is to be used for tests\n" >&2
printf " -m install/noinstall make install pgpool to temp directory for executing regression tests [Default: install]\n" >&2
printf " -j FILE Postgres jdbc jar file path\n" >&2
printf " -s DIRECTORY unix socket directory\n" >&2
printf " -t TIMEOUT timeout value for each test (sec)\n" >&2
printf " -c test pgpool using sample scripts and config files\n" >&2
printf " -d start pgpool with debug option\n" >&2
printf " -? print this help and then exit\n\n" >&2
printf "Please read the README for details on adding new tests\n" >&2
}
trap "echo ; exit 0" SIGINT SIGQUIT
while getopts "p:m:i:j:b:s:t:cd?" OPTION
do
case $OPTION in
p) PG_INSTALL_DIR="$OPTARG";;
m) MODE="$OPTARG";;
i) PGPOOL_PATH="$OPTARG";;
j) JDBC_DRIVER="$OPTARG";;
b) PGBENCH_PATH="$OPTARG";;
s) PGSOCKET_DIR="$OPTARG";;
t) TIMEOUT="$OPTARG";;
c) export TEST_SAMPLES="true";;
d) export PGPOOLDEBUG="true";;
?) print_usage
exit 2;;
esac
done
shift $(($OPTIND - 1))
if [ "$MODE" = "install" ]; then
install_pgpool
elif [ "$MODE" = "noinstall" ]; then
echo not installing pgpool for the tests ...
if [[ -n "$PGPOOL_INSTALL_DIR" ]]; then
PGPOOL_PATH=$PGPOOL_INSTALL_DIR
fi
export PGPOOL_SETUP=$PGPOOL_PATH/bin/pgpool_setup
export WATCHDOG_SETUP=$PGPOOL_PATH/bin/watchdog_setup
else
echo $MODE : Invalid mode
exit -1
fi
verify_pginstallation
export_env_vars
print_info
source $TESTLIBS
#Start executing tests
rm -fr $log
mkdir $log
cd tests
if [ $# -eq 1 ];then
dirs=`ls|grep $1`
else
dirs=`ls`
fi
for i in $dirs
do
cd $i
# skip the test if there's no test.sh
if [ ! -f test.sh ];then
cd ..
continue;
fi
echo -n "testing $i..."
clean_all
timeout $TIMEOUT ./test.sh > $log/$i 2>&1
rtn=$?
check_segfault
if [ $? -eq 0 ];then
echo "fail: Segmentation fault detected" >> $log/$i
segfault=1
rtn=1
fi
if [ $rtn = 0 ];then
echo ${CGREEN}"ok."${CNORM}
ok=`expr $ok + 1`
elif [ $rtn = 124 ];then
echo "timeout."
timeout=`expr $timeout + 1`
else
if [ "$segfault" = "1" ];then
echo ${CRED}"segfault."${CNORM}
else
echo ${CRED}"failed."${CNORM}
fi
fail=`expr $fail + 1`
fi
cd ..
done
total=`expr $ok + $fail + $timeout`
echo "out of $total ok:$ok failed:$fail timeout:$timeout"
